What 1952 tells you about the pipe in Glenside
Housing of this vintage generally means galvanized steel still the norm, with copper appearing towards the end of the decade. A house from these years may have had part of its supply replaced and part left alone, which is why pressure can be fine in one bathroom and poor in another. More on 1950s supply pipe.

Before calling anyone in Glenside, check whether every tap is weak or just one. Normal supply is 45–80 psi and under 40 psi is low — how to test it in a minute. Whole house is a supply problem worth a call; one tap is usually a five-minute job you can do yourself.
